xkbscan: Copy, rather than assign, file name For some reason, lex decided to reduce a strcpy into an assignment, leading to entirely justified valgrind warnings about invalid reads, when scanFile was set to a string which may have only ever lived on the stack of a now-exited function. Make it a strdup() instead. Signed-off-by: Daniel Stone <daniel@fooishbar.org>
